Proliferation assays were undertaken in an attempt to ascertain the optimal dose of IR to maximize cytokine production while minimizing cell death. (A) Proliferation assays after radiation exposure demonstrated a dose of 5 Gy to yield the optimal setting of cytokine up-regulation with minimal cell death (n = 6). (B) Apoptotis of hypoxic cells with and without 5 Gy radiation exposure was assessed by annexin V expression. Cells exposed to 5 Gy radiation showed a decrease in apoptosis, suggesting a cytoprotective role. This dose was therefore used for all subsequent experiments (n = 3).
